This is why I'd like to see a new design in .30 Carbine (and probably 5.7x28mm as well), perhaps something along the lines of the Kel-Tec SU-16, Ares SCR or a basic Saiga. I don't mean just chambering one of those in .30 Carbine, which negates the advantage of the smaller cartridge, I mean a modern polymer and metal gun designed around the cartridge. That certainly should not cost $900.
With regard to the 5.7x28, what you're describing sounds exactly like the p90/ps90. That weapon was designed specifically for the 5.7x28 round. The ps90 is 26" in overall length and weighs 6.6 pounds when loaded with 50 rounds -- hard to get much lighter/smaller than that.
